A space-saving solution for hanging towels and clothes. This clever rack takes up virtually no room - installs easily on almost any door hinges. Gives you 8 feet of towel bar space without using up any wall space! This Door-Hinge Towel and Clothes Rack consists of five 19" x 5/8" tubular polished stainless steel arms that swing individually for easy access. The swing-arms screw into a 69"x 3/4"-diameter stainless steel pole with adjustable brackets for up to 67" hinge spacing. Decreases clutter and reduces laundry by providing a convenient place to hang up damp towels and just-worn clothing. Eliminates unsightly wet towels hanging over the shower curtain rod and door knobs or thrown on the floor. This is a great idea but lousy design. The biggest issue is that the main rod is made up of several pieces that fall apart under the weight of the towels. Also the piece that attaches to the door hinge is rounded, not flat like a washer. This causes the door hinge to not be fully in place, and the rounded part breaks easily when you try to remove it. I will be trying a different Hinge-It towel rack that should address these issues because the basic concept is great for small bathrooms like mine.

Was missing one of the piecs so I improvised by converting a ball end to a straight piece by using a hacksaw. Finally got it together on a two hinge door. Not enough support - it just falls apart when you look at it. Instructions say you can purchase supports separately - what's with that? If they know they have a problem, why not package it with the product? I improvised my own support with electrical ties nailed to the door trim. Recommend you only install on a three hinge door.
